Automate Recurring Tasks
One of the most effective ways to increase output in operational service is to automate recurring tasks.
Using the help of software, you can automate routine processes such as data management, reporting, and inventory tracking.
This not only saves time but also reduces the likelihood of human error.
Through automating these tasks, you can free up your staff to focus on more critical and essential tasks.
Implement a Knowledge Repository
A knowledge base is a centralized archive of knowledge that provides answers to frequently asked questions and remedies to common challenges.
By implementing a knowledge repository, you can minimize the time spent on resolving challenges and improve primary resolution results.
A well-designed knowledge database can also offer as a valuable tool for new staff, helping them to quickly acquire up to speed and become effective.
Analyze and Optimize Operations
Operational effort processes can be complex and require multiple actors.
Therefore, it is essential to frequently analyze and optimize these operations to eliminate bottlenecks and improve efficiency.
Apply techniques such as process mapping and bottleneck analysis to identify areas for enhancement, and apply changes to sustain operations.
This can involve streamlining processes reducing handoffs and eliminating unnecessary steps.
Develop a Service Level Agreement
A Service Level Arrangement (SLA) is a critical element of operational support, providing a clear comprehension of service performance and expectations.
Via developing an SLA, you can specify service targets, such as response periods and resolution results.
This can help to improve reporting between teams and stakeholders, reducing conflicts and mismatches.
Collaborate with Stakeholders
Operational support is often a cross-functional endeavor, involving multiple teams and actors.
Therefore, it is essential to collaborate with stakeholders to recognize needs and priorities.
Conduct frequent meetings and reviews to collect feedback and input, and involve stakeholders in the decision-making process.
This can assist to ensure that operational service is aligned with business targets and that products meet client needs.

Implement a Feedback Loop
A feedback cycle is a critical component of operational effort, enabling you to gather feedback and input from participants and employees.
Through implementing a feedback cycle, you can discover areas for optimization and make research-based decisions.
This can require regular reviews, meetings, and review sessions, as well as tools such as performance summaries and benchmarks.
